What is the AQF?

The Australian Qualifications Framework acts as the national policy regarding regulated qualifications in the Australian learning and training system. Bringing together qualifications from each education and training sector within a unified framework, including schools, vocational education and training (VET), and higher learning institutions.

Relevant AQF Levels for RTOs

The AQF comprises levels, where each level each specifying the complexity and depth of learning outcomes. This guide focuses on the AQF levels most pertinent to RTOs and vocational education, particularly levels 1 to 6.

AQF Level 1: Certificate I

- Summary: Certificate I represents the entry-level qualification that provides basic functional knowledge and skills to initiate work, community participation, or further learning.
- Expertise and Knowledge: Foundational knowledge and skills for routine tasks. Basic operational skills with the capability to utilise them within a defined setting.
- Usage: Ideal for entry-level roles and positions needing basic skills. Typically serves as a foundation for further learning and learning.

Certificate II: AQF Level 2

- Introduction: Building on the skills from Certificate I, Certificate II provides, offering more advanced capabilities considered suitable for a range of roles.
- Expertise and Knowledge: A broader range of skills for particular tasks. Capability to execute routine tasks and solve anticipated problems.
- Implementation: Appropriate for roles demanding fundamental operational knowledge and abilities. Serves as a stepping stone for further learning and beginner roles.

Understanding AQF Level 3: Certificate III

- Summary: Delivering advanced technical and theoretical knowledge, Certificate III is with skills suitable for skilled jobs and further learning.

Expertise and Proficiency:Detailed knowledge of specific areas and the capability to implement it. Skills to undertake a series of sophisticated operations and addressing unexpected challenges. Appropriate for use: Suitable for trades and technical roles. Frequently necessary for trainee and apprenticeship programmes.

AQF Level Four: Certificate IV

Introduction: IV Certification offers sophisticated skills and understanding for upper-tier positions and additional learning. Proficiency and Understanding: Comprehensive theory and practical skills in a focused area. Abilities for leading and guiding colleagues, and administering and overseeing operations. Appropriate for use: Appropriate for technical and supervisory positions. Setting the groundwork for higher academic or focussed vocational training.

Diploma (AQF Level 5): Diploma Tier 5

Summary: Diploma certifications offer sophisticated theoretical and hands-on proficiency and expertise for professional engagements and continued education. Talent and Expertise: Comprehensive insight and expertise suited for technical and paraprofessional tasks. Capacity to review and apply know-how in diverse contexts. Practical Usage: Tailored for technical and managerial work. Frequently a requirement for continued higher education.

AQF Level 6: Associate Degree and Advanced Diploma

General Description: Advanced Diploma and Associate Degree certificates deliver elevated theoretical and hands-on proficiency. Proficiency and Understanding: Upper-tier expertise and comprehension for complicated technical/theory environments. Equips for professional tasks or extended bachelor-level education. Appropriate for use: Appropriate for higher technical, paraprofessional, and management jobs. Regularly used for earning credit in bachelor degree tracks.

Significance of AQF Adherence for RTOs

Ensuring Quality and Accreditation

Upholding Standards: Compliance with AQF ensures qualifications by RTOs correspond with national training and education standards.

Official Recognition: To gain and retain accreditation from bodies such as ASQA (Australian Skills Quality Authority), RTO compliance is vital.

Academic Pathways

- Easy Transitions: The AQF supports seamless transitions across various educational sectors. facilitating learners easier for learners to progress through their educational and career routes.
- Recognition of Prior Learning: The AQF supports prior learning (RPL) recognition. facilitating the awarding of credits for previous studies or work experience.
